*
:Đoạn chương trình sau cho kết quả là gì?For i := 1 to 20 do if i mod 2 = 0 then write(i, ‘ ’); *
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20
2 4 6 8 10 12 14 16 18 20
Chương trình báo lỗi
1 3 5 7 9 11 13 15 17 19
*
:Đoạn chương trình sau cho kết quả là gì?For i := 1 to 20 do if i mod 2 = 0 then write(i, ‘ ’); *
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20
2 4 6 8 10 12 14 16 18 20
Chương trình báo lỗi
1 3 5 7 9 11 13 15 17 19
Đoạn ct trên cho ta biết kết quả được in ra màn hình là các số chẵn từ 1 đến 20 nha, vì i mod 2=0 tức là cho i chia hết cho 2(ko dư) thì mới in số đó ra, nên các số chẵn sẽ in ra màn hình khi chạy chương trình.
***Chúc bạnu làm bài tốt nha***
Đoạn chương trình có chức năng in ra các số chẵn từ 1 đến 20, mỗi số cách nhau 1 dâu cách.
`=>`B: 2 4 6 8 10 12 14 16 18 20